SALE OF GOOD CRAZING FARM. SATURDAY, NOVEMBER 26. NEWTON KING I*AS been favored with instructions to offer by auction at his Mart, Devon street, New Plymouth, on SATURDAY, November 25, GOOD GRAZING FARM, comprising—--329 ACRES, being Section I, Block VIII., and Section 4, Block VII., MIMI. Survey District. This property is situated on the Main road (which is metalled to the farm) at Uruti, about 27 miles from Waitara. It consists of rolling country, subdivided into convenient paddocks, and is all in grass, with the exception of some 70 acres of bush and fern. On the farm are good five-roomed house with verandah, woolshed and sheep pens, sheep dip, six-bail cowshed, trap shed, tool house and good orchard. Water is laid on to the house from a good spring. The Awakino Coach passes the property three times a week. There is a dairy factory, store, post and telephone office within five miles by good metalled road, and a school within one mile of the TlTLE:'—Lease in Perpetuity at Is per acre. Further particulars supplied on application. Sale at 2 o'clock. N.Z. LOAN & MERCANTILE AGENCY CO., LTD., STRATFORD. LIST OF CiALES i FOR NOVEMBER— Saturday, 25 Stratford springing heifer sale.
